StockNews.com Lowers Intevac (NASDAQ:IVAC) to Sell

StockNews.com downgraded shares of Intevac (NASDAQ:IVACFree Report) from a hold rating to a sell rating in a research note published on Friday.

Intevac Stock Down 4.1 %

IVAC opened at $4.21 on Friday. The business has a 50 day moving average price of $3.84 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$3.90. The company has a market cap of $111.90 million, a PE ratio of -11.08 and a beta of 0.73. Intevac has a 52 week low of $3.07 and a 52 week high of $6.48.

Intevac (NASDAQ:IVACG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 25th. The electronics maker reported ($0.10) EPS for the quarter. The company had revenue of $9.63 million for the quarter. Intevac had a negative net margin of 19.52% and a negative return on equity of 8.17%.

About Intevac

(Get Free Report)

Intevac,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the designing, developing, and manufacturing thin-film processing systems in the United States, Europe, and Asia. It designs, develops, and markets vacuum process equipment solutions for manufacturing small substrates with precise thin-film properties, such as hard disk drive, advanced coatings, and other adjacent thin-film markets.
